CBDT has entered into 26 APAs in the first 5 months of the current financial year (April to August, 2019). With the signing of these APAs, the total number of APAs entered into by the CBDT as of now stand at 297, which includes 32 BAPAs.

Project Imports Scheme provides that all the goods imported for the purpose of setting up of Industrial Project or substantial expansion of existing industrial projects be subjected to single classification under heading 98.01 of Custom Tariff Act, 1975 and single rate of duty instead of merit assessment of imported goods.

Exporter of gold/silver/platinum jewellery and articles thereof including mountings and findings may obtain gold/silver/platinum as an input for export product from Nominated Agency, in advance or as replenishment after export in accordance with the procedure specified in this behalf.
